PubMed PubMed Product Detail Regulator of G protein signaling (RGS) family members are regulatory molecules that act as GTPase activating proteins (GAPs) for G alpha subunits of heterotrimeric G proteins. RGS proteins are able to deactivate G protein subunits of the Gi alpha, Go alpha and Gq alpha subtypes. They drive G proteins into their inactive GDP-bound forms. Regulator of G protein signaling 2 belongs to this family. The protein acts as a mediator of myeloid differentiation and may play a role in leukemogenesis. [provided by RefSeq].
Function:
Inhibits signal transduction by increasing the GTPase activity of G protein alpha subunits thereby driving them into their inactive GDP-bound form. May play a role in leukemogenesis. Plays a role in negative feedback control pathway for adenylyl cyclase signaling. Binds EIF2B5 and blocks its activity, thereby inhibiting the translation of mRNA into protein.
Subunit:
Interacts with EIF2B5. Interacts with PRKG1 (isoform alpha).
Subcellular Location:
Isoform 1: Cell membrane. Cytoplasm. Nucleus, nucleolus.
Isoform 2: Cell membrane. Cytoplasm. Nucleus, nucleolus.
Isoform 3: Cell membrane. Cytoplasm. Nucleus, nucleolus.
Isoform 4: Cell membrane. Mitochondrion.
Tissue Specificity:
Expressed in acute myelogenous leukemia (AML) and in acute lymphoblastic leukemia (ALL).
Post-translational modifications:
Phosphorylated by protein kinase C. Phosphorylation by PRKG1 leads to activation of RGS2 activity.
Similarity:
Contains 1 RGS domain.
